Support and stability in turbulent times

Another year draws to a close, and what a year it has been. 2022 has reminded all of us – once again – how quickly things can change. Business patterns, outlooks, expectations – all can suddenly be disrupted by world affairs.

Published 20 December 2022

Perhaps no wonder, then, that “permacrisis” has been named as the word of the year by the editors of the Collins English Dictionary. Defined as “an extended period of instability and insecurity”, it seems to summarize what many of us have been navigating for quite some time now.

In the midst of this, Gard’s role is to provide stability and reassurance. We are here to help. Focusing on the fundamentals – understanding risks and preventing losses – we have delivered yet another year with remarkably strong insurance results, reconfirming the high quality of our Membership. This leaves us well-positioned to face the future. It means that we can continue to offer stable and competitive premiums to our Members and clients. It means that we can continue to provide support and guidance when you need us. In times like these, that is perhaps more important than ever.

With the holiday season approaching for many, another topic needs to be stressed: the continued need to put seafarers’ welfare front and centre. Positive changes are happening in many regards – Gard launched an international medical app this year, tailored specifically to seafarers. Moreover, the pandemic is receding in many countries, and some of the crew change challenges we have grappled with over the last few years have largely been resolved. The fact remains, however, that many of the world’s seafarers continue to be under significant pressure. Some are even persecuted and criminalized, with little or no regard for basic human rights. A grim reminder that our work for seafarer justice is far from done.

Faced with these and other challenges, the maritime industry needs to show what we are made of. We need to work together, and to rally around our shared principles and our shared institutions – the IMO, the ICS, and the International Group of P&I Clubs to mention a few. Standing alone, we can only do so much. Standing together, we can do a lot. Together, we can work for a fairer, safer, and more sustainable maritime industry.
